London is the top global destination for property investment from Gulf states in spite of turbulent market headwinds, according to a new report from the Al Rayan Bank.
The 2023 Gulf Cooperation Council (GCC) Investment Barometer, which surveyed 150 investors from Saudi Arabia, Qatar and the UAE with an average net worth of $208m, found that a third (33%) had bought property in London over the last 12 months – more than any other major global market.
